Elevated Parking Systems

In densely populated urban areas where space is a premium, vertical parking systems present an innovative and efficient method to the ever-growing challenge of car parking. These systems maximize deployment of available height space by piling vehicles in a multi-tiered configuration, often utilizing automated lifts to transport vehicles between levels. This minimizes the overall footprint required for parking compared to traditional surface-level parking lots, freeing valuable ground for other purposes.

  • Additionally, vertical parking systems often incorporate features such as security measures and remote access, boosting user convenience.
  • Despite their benefits, vertical parking systems can be sophisticated to implement, and the first expenses can be significant.

However, as cities continue to grow, vertical parking systems are emerging as a viable option to traditional parking methods, offering a more effective and environmentally friendly approach to vehicle storage in the future.

Self-Driving Multi-Level Parking Structures

Modern urban settings face a growing challenge: accommodating the increasing number of vehicles while maximizing valuable land usage. Confronting this problem, automated multi-level parking structures have emerged as a innovative solution. These sophisticated systems utilize advanced more info technologies like cameras and algorithms to optimally guide vehicles into designated parking spaces. This process not only eliminates the need for human staff but also streamlines traffic flow and reduces congestion within lots.

  • Advantages of automated multi-level parking structures include:
  • Increased parking capacity
  • Improved traffic flow and reduced congestion
  • Lowered need for human labor
  • More Secure parking experience
  • Increased property value
